Park Street to get transit signal priority under MTC BusAid quick-build project
Summary
AC Transit and consultant Kimley-Horn outlined a Bus Accelerated Infrastructure Delivery (Bus Aid) project to extend transit-signal priority and wireless interconnect on Park Street (Blanding to Otis), upgrade controllers, and run a before/after evaluation; construction is planned for spring with traffic maintained.
AC Transit staff and consultant Kimley-Horn presented the Park Street transit-signal-priority (TSP) and signal optimization project at the Feb. 12 ILC, describing equipment upgrades, wireless interconnect and a pre/post evaluation intended to speed buses and improve reliability along the corridor.
Ryan Gold of Kimley-Horn explained that the project will extend existing TSP (currently between Landing and Central Avenue) all the way to Otis, add wireless interconnect so signals can coordinate, and upgrade controllers and wiring at older intersections such as Park Street and San Jose.
